I can't quite believe I am saying this, but I am really impressed with Currys!
Bought a microwave from them seven months ago, it keeps cutting out so took it back today. From past experience and from reports on here, I expected them to offer (at most) a repair. However, I went in, explained the problem, and was offered an apology (rare in any shop nowadays) and a replacement!
Very impressed ... and it's not often I say that about anyone!

I bought a laptop with a year long warranty from curry's and after 363 days (at about 4pm on a Friday) it stopped working. We called up the helpline and were told they would collect from us on the Monday. We were concerned that would take us out of the warranty but they insisted that as we called on the Friday (Day 363) we would be ok.
They came at 9am on the Monday, and returned it fully functional on the Wednesday. We were more than happy than that result.0 -

All microwaves are code 5 items except panasonic (not sure about samsung)
This means they are a straight swap in the even tof a fault, so even though panasonic are a better brand its more of a pain in the backside when something goes wrong as panasonic insist on repair0
